117/2/8/7 Correspondence 1964-1972<br />
Mainly letters between <strong>First</strong> and <strong>of</strong>ficials at <strong>the</strong> United Nations, and<br />
some with <strong>the</strong> International Commission <strong>of</strong> Jurists, Amnesty<br />
International and o<strong>the</strong>r organisations. Many enclosures are included,<br />
such as statements, reports or o<strong>the</strong>r background <strong>material</strong>.<br />

117/2/8/9 Statement <strong>by</strong> <strong>Ruth</strong> <strong>First</strong> to <strong>the</strong> Special Committee on <strong>the</strong> Policies<br />
<strong>of</strong> Apar<strong>the</strong>id <strong>of</strong> <strong>the</strong> Government <strong>of</strong> <strong>the</strong> Republic <strong>of</strong> South Africa<br />
Describes conditions for political prisoners, <strong>the</strong> nature <strong>of</strong> detention<br />
under <strong>the</strong> 90 Day Law etc.<br />
